In the heart of El Reino de Elysoria, the city of Arcanea twinkled with anticipation. Mepacho adjusted her leather travel satchel, her hazel eyes following the glittering golden bridges stretching over crystalline rivers. 'This city is even grander than I imagined, Lia,' she half-whispered to her sister, her voice tinged with awe. Lia, with her braided dark hair and soft gaze, merely nodded, fighting her own shiver of trepidation.

'I heard the king himself invited women from every corner of Elysoria,' Lia replied.

Mepacho sighed, her mind drifting to the farm and its silent plea for help. "Well, here we are, ready to prove we're more than destiny threw upon us," she said with determined resolve.

In the grand hall of the castle, murmurs of silk and glints of candlelight shimmered in a dance of anticipation. Opposite the room, an imposing figure edged through the crowd—Lady Verena, whose reputation for weaving intrigues was as mysterious as the black velvet robes she wore.

Her sharp blue eyes settled on Mepacho. "And you are…?" she purred, her voice both sweet and sinister.

Mepacho stood firm, unflinching, "Mepacho, daughter of Finn and Alanna," she replied, her voice as steadfast as her gaze.

Lady Verena raised a brow, her aura almost rhythmic in scrutiny. "A wonder, it is, when rumors bring questions of origin..."

Lia bristled beside Mepacho, placing a reassuring hand on her sister's arm. "Our roots may have mysteries, but our hearts are steady," she murmured softly, hazel eyes meeting the azure in a calm rebellion.

Mepacho reached for the amethyst pendant around her neck, a sparkling emblem Finn and Alanna had given her. "And this," she declared, "speaks of where I've belonged for all my heart's life."

The other women glanced at them, whispers weaving a tapestry of wary respect.

With their position undeterred, Mepacho turned towards the sprawling gardens visible through the open arches, their lush greenery promising both solace and challenge. In the serenity of Elysoria, she found her resolve—a quiet, vast strength, far greater than any court intrigue.
